                        • Re: Maine Recruit Updates: The Search for Spock

                          Ryan Lomberg (The Hill Prep) - N/A


                          fwiw, the hill prep has been just taking people apart so far this season. record so far is 13-1 and they are outscoring their opponents 58-6. competition they have been facing are u-18 teams and teams like the jr. flyers (u-18 midget aaa), jr. bobcats(u-18 midget aaa), rothesay netherwood school, etc. one of the few close games was a 2-1 win over the compuware u-18 team... not sure how much to take away as it appears that they have been rarely tested...

                          http://www.thehillacademy.com/ath_hillprep_schedule.php
